A multi generational family of witches, cursed to be loveless for centuries, attempts to break the spell by confronting dark secrets and sacrificing for each other.
1984
1916
1965
2019
2027
2016
2013
2031
1982
2008
1972
1989
—
2018
2015
2022
2014
2024